Understanding the 2009 Audi A4: A Brief Overview ππ§
The 2009 Audi A4 was a significant year for the model, offering a blend of style and substance. Available in both sedan and Avant (wagon) variants, the A4 boasted a range of engine options, including a 2.0-liter turbocharged four-cylinder and a 3.2-liter V6. The interior was a testament to German engineering, with high-quality materials and a focus on comfort and technology. ππ οΈ
Current Market Prices: What Can You Expect? π°π
The price of a 2009 Audi A4 can vary widely depending on factors like mileage, condition, and location. On average, you can expect to pay between $5,000 and $10,000 for a well-maintained 2009 A4. However, prices can drop significantly for higher-mileage vehicles or those in need of repairs. ππ
Hereβs a rough breakdown:
- Low Mileage (under 75,000 miles): $8,000 - $10,000
- Moderate Mileage (75,000 - 125,000 miles): $5,000 - $8,000
- High Mileage (over 125,000 miles): $3,000 - $5,000
Remember, these are just estimates. Always have a pre-purchase inspection to ensure youβre getting a reliable vehicle. π οΈπ¨βπ§
Pros and Cons: Is It Right for You? ππ
Pros:
- Reliability: Audi A4s are known for their durability and long-lasting performance.
- Luxury Features: Even older models come packed with modern amenities like Bluetooth connectivity, climate control, and premium sound systems.
- Resale Value: Audis tend to hold their value well, making them a smart long-term investment.
Cons:
- Maintenance Costs: Luxury cars often come with higher repair and maintenance costs.
- Fuel Efficiency: While the 2.0-liter turbo is relatively efficient, the V6 models can be thirsty.
- Technology Obsolescence: Older models may lack the latest safety and infotainment features found in newer cars.
